As you've noticed information in English on them is pretty scarce online. The couple threads on this forum and Shibui Swords are pretty much the only ones I'm aware of. However I have intrest of this type and have some literary sources which contain information about katate-uchi in English. You will want to check Koto-kantei by Markus Sesko, also Nihonto Koza and Yamanaka Newsletters _________________ Jussi Ekholm Tks JussiSan i will look for those books for more study.
